The length of under-reamed piles is about 3 m to 8 m. The thing to look out for is the letter or letters after the size. It varies by manufacturer but, in general, N = narrow, M = medium, W or D = wide, XW or 2E = extra wide and 4E = extra extra wide. In general Wide are quite easy to find, and 2E are pretty common as well. If you need the 4E then you’re going to have to hunt around a bit, I’m afraid. I don’t have a go to source for that.
